Wetumka is located in Oklahoma. Wetumka, Oklahoma has a population of 1,294. Wetumka is less family-centric than the surrounding county with 14.42% of the households containing married families with children. The county average for households married with children is 23.31%.
The median household income in Wetumka, Oklahoma is $24,769. The median household income for the surrounding county is $42,425 compared to the national median of $69,021. The median age of people living in Wetumka is 41.8 years.
The average high temperature in July is 93.3 degrees, with an average low temperature in January of 29 degrees. The average rainfall is approximately 43.1 inches per year, with 5 inches of snow per year.
